Betty Ann Charland, 86, of Virginia, IL, died Sunday, February 9, 2025, at Arcadia Care in Havana.
She was born August 2, 1938, in Virginia, the daughter of Clarence and Nellie (Lynn) Gentry.
Betty is survived by her four children, Cathy (Michael) Brown of McDonough, GA, Billy (Tonya) Brunk of Jacksonville, and Ruth (Tom) Simmons and Rick (Kimberly) Brunk, both of Virginia; eleven grandchildren, Aaron Brown, Stephen (Ericka) Brown, Brandon Miller, Billy Brunk III, Ace Brunk, Niki (Tony) Walters, Keri Gaines, Brandi Pascal, Jodi Pascal, Hannah Simmons, and Kayla Brunk; and twelve great grandchildren.
She was preceded in death by her parents; three sisters, Maudine, Mary Lou, and Karen; one brother, Jesse; and one granddaughter, Brittany Brunk.
Betty ran an in-home daycare out of her home in Virginia for several years and even fostered a few kids during that time as well. She loved to garden, sew, and walk. Betty was a devoted mother and grandmother. Family was her life.
Cremation rites will be accorded and there will be a private burial at Walnut Ridge Cemetery in Virginia at a later date. Memorial donations are suggested to Alzheimer's Association or to Arcadia Care at Havana. The Buchanan & Cody Funeral Home in Virginia is in charge of the arrangements.
